According to the meteorological department's forecast, affected by the continuous impact of this round of strong cold air, Guangxi will continue to have overcast, rainy, and cold weather for the next three days. Some areas in northern Guangxi will experience rain, snow, and freezing weather, with temperatures continuing to drop by 6-8°C across various regions.



As of now, Guangxi Power Grid has not experienced any line tripping incidents due to ice coating. A total of 4 lines of 110 kV and above have ice coating, among which the ground wire of Tower No. 5 on the 110 kV Jinzhongwang Line has an ice thickness of 12.11mm, with an ice-to-wire ratio of 0.43. Based on the ice-to-wire ratio, the company will carry out DC ice-melting work on this line again after the 28th.



In response to the severe situation of this cold air being stronger, with lower temperatures and a wider range of rain and snow, China Southern Power Grid Guangxi Power Grid Company has taken proactive measures in advance, implementing various defensive measures, conducting line inspections, ice observation, and substation duty, effectively coping with low-temperature rain and snow to ensure power supply. To strengthen anti-icing and ice-resistant work in high-altitude cold regions, power supply bureaus in Liuzhou, Guilin, Hechi, Baise, Hezhou, and others have also issued yellow warnings, making proactive preparations for power load forecasting and grid operation arrangements under super cold wave weather. In particular, they have formulated emergency plans and risk control measures for potential ice-coated line outages, completed the replacement and addition of online ice monitoring terminals for transmission lines, inspected and maintained ice-melting and ice-coating monitoring devices, and completed maintenance tests for fixed ice-melting devices, mobile ice-melting devices, and distribution mobile ice-melting vehicles, ensuring the normal operation of anti-icing and ice-melting devices.
